OREANDA-NEWS. October 28, 2008. At the GAZ Group head-office in Nizhny Novrorod, TRW Automotive Holdings Corp. showed its portfolio of automotive safety systems and components at an ‘Innovation Day’, reported the press-centre of GAZ Group.

The GAZ Group management – employees from its United Engineering Center, divisions and plants – will participate in workshops on the latest TRW safety systems: braking, steering, safety electronics, seatbelt and airbag systems and review an exhibition of TRW technologies.

GAZ Group already cooperates with TRW Automotive: TRW delivers safety systems for the MAXUS LCV (airbags and safety belts) and for Volga Siber cars (braking components, part of the steering system, airbags and climate control).
